Transaction 5767ac073355dc95a1d08e355fa54fb2d72e4c7f56e15a7316f40f3139237621

1 Input
2 Outputs
  • 5767ac073355dc95a1d08e355fa54fb2d72e4c7f56e15a7316f40f3139237621:0
  • value  558343920
    address  39CgPLWM19TZdMwpboxputrvWQpWzLtBon
  • 5767ac073355dc95a1d08e355fa54fb2d72e4c7f56e15a7316f40f3139237621:1
  • value  2905000
    address  3KEYaiQhBPr6rkk8sMNuivf1HAjJXD9uSv